APY: Why a "5% Rate" and a "5% APY" Are Not the Same Amount of Money
Savings accounts advertise a number that looks simple, but a rate quoted without its compounding frequency hides part of the picture. Annual percentage yield fixes this by expressing exactly what a dollar actually earns over a year, which is why it, not the stated rate, is the number worth comparing across banks.
The core principle
The annual percentage yield (APY) is the true annual return on a deposit once the effect of compounding is included, as opposed to the stated nominal interest rate alone. The formula is APY = (1 + r/n)^n − 1, where r is the stated annual rate and n is the number of times per year interest compounds. Because interest that has already been credited starts earning its own interest before the year is over, APY is always equal to or higher than the plain stated rate, and the gap widens as compounding happens more frequently, monthly beating annually, daily beating monthly.
This is not a trivial distinction. Banks are required to disclose APY specifically because a bare interest rate, without knowing the compounding frequency, does not tell you what you will actually earn. Two accounts can advertise numbers that look close but compound differently enough to matter once real dollars and multiple years are involved.
The reason this disclosure requirement exists at all traces back to a period when banks routinely advertised the more flattering of two numbers, the stated rate rather than the yield, precisely because the stated rate always looks smaller and therefore feels more conservative and trustworthy, even though the account paying it can genuinely earn you less. Standardizing the required disclosure to APY specifically closed that loophole for savings products, though the same discipline does not automatically extend to every investment product marketed with a "yield," a word that gets used more loosely, and sometimes far less precisely, outside of federally insured deposit accounts. A bond fund's advertised "yield," for instance, is not calculated the same way as a bank's APY and often reflects a snapshot estimate rather than a guaranteed, compounding return, which is worth remembering the first time an unfamiliar yield figure is used to sell you something.
How the math works
Example 1: converting a stated rate into APY at different frequencies. Take a 5% stated annual rate. Compounded monthly, APY = (1 + 0.05/12)^12 − 1 ≈ 5.12%. Compounded daily, APY = (1 + 0.05/365)^365 − 1 ≈ 5.13%. Notice how little additional yield daily compounding adds over monthly, just one hundredth of a percentage point, even though daily compounding sounds like it should matter a great deal more. Most of the benefit of compounding frequency is captured by the time you reach monthly; pushing further toward daily or continuous compounding delivers diminishing, and eventually negligible, extra return. There is a hard mathematical ceiling here, too: as the number of compounding periods per year approaches infinity, the formula converges to a fixed limit tied to the mathematical constant e, roughly 2.71828, so no bank, no matter how aggressively it compounds, can push a 5% stated rate meaningfully past about 5.13% through frequency alone. Marketing that emphasizes "compounded continuously" is describing a real but very small edge over daily compounding, not a fundamentally different product.
Example 2: the cost of projecting savings with simple interest instead of APY. Suppose $25,000 sits in a CD earning a disclosed 5% APY for four years. Because APY already represents the effective annual growth rate, the correct future value is $25,000 x (1.05)^4 ≈ $30,388. A saver who instead assumes the account grows by a flat $1,250 a year, treating 5% as simple, non-compounding interest, would project $25,000 + (4 x $1,250) = $30,000, undercounting the real result by roughly $388. On a modest four-year, $25,000 balance the gap is a few hundred dollars; on a larger balance held over a longer stretch, the same mistake compounds into a materially larger planning error.
How it shows up in real portfolios
The most common real-world trap is comparing one bank's advertised "rate" to another bank's advertised "APY" as if they were the same kind of number. A bank quoting a 4.75% rate compounded monthly is actually offering an APY of roughly 4.86%, which may beat a competitor advertising a flat 4.80% APY outright, even though the first number on the page looked smaller. Converting every offer to APY before comparing is the only way to see which account genuinely pays more.
A relevant high-earning-professional scenario involves someone parking a large sum, say $150,000 from a bonus or a liquidity event, into a high-yield savings account or a short CD ladder while deciding on a longer-term use for the cash. At that scale, even a small APY gap between competing accounts, the kind of half-point difference that looks trivial on a small balance, translates into a genuinely material dollar amount over a year, which is exactly the sort of decision where converting every offer to APY before comparing is worth the extra few minutes.
A second common pattern involves promotional APYs designed to attract new deposits. A bank might advertise a headline 5.25% APY that only applies for the first three months on new money, after which the account reverts to a base APY closer to 4.00%. Someone who parks a large tax refund or bonus into that account expecting to earn 5.25% for a full year, without reading the fine print on the promotional period, ends up earning a blended rate meaningfully lower than the number that drew them in. The advertised APY was accurate for the period it applied to; the mistake was assuming it applied indefinitely.
A third pattern worth understanding involves CDs specifically, where the advertised APY assumes the deposit stays untouched for the full term. Early withdrawal typically forfeits some portion of accrued interest, commonly a few months' worth on a short-term CD, which means the realized APY on a CD broken early can fall well short of the number printed on the certificate. Someone locking $40,000 into an 18-month CD advertising 4.90% APY, only to need the cash after nine months, might forfeit three months of interest as a penalty, turning what looked like a straightforward 4.90% return into something closer to 3.5% or 4% once the penalty is netted out, a gap worth weighing against the flexibility of a high-yield savings account paying a slightly lower but fully liquid rate.

Common pitfalls
- Comparing one bank's stated rate directly against another bank's APY, which is not an apples-to-apples comparison and will systematically make the rate-quoting bank look worse than it may actually be.
- Assuming a marginally higher APY always wins, without checking fees or minimum balance requirements that can offset it, since a monthly maintenance fee can easily erase a small yield advantage on a modest balance.
- Overestimating how much compounding frequency alone changes real earnings once you move past monthly compounding, when the genuinely meaningful lever is the underlying rate itself, not how often it compounds.
- Using simple interest math to project savings growth over several years instead of the correct compounded APY figure, an error that grows larger the longer the money sits and the larger the balance involved.

The bottom line
APY is the honest number for comparing savings products because it already captures the effect of compounding that a stated rate leaves out, and converting every competing offer to that same figure before opening an account is the only reliable way to know which one actually pays more.
